Chromium Code Reviews| Index: ui/views/widget/native_widget_aura.cc |
| diff --git a/ui/views/widget/native_widget_aura.cc b/ui/views/widget/native_widget_aura.cc |
| index 1f72f3a80b73b784d387dc4fb401b40ea312b728..fdc986c14ced675325543a64439508cdbfc45c35 100644 |
| --- a/ui/views/widget/native_widget_aura.cc |
| +++ b/ui/views/widget/native_widget_aura.cc |
| @@ -355,7 +355,11 @@ bool NativeWidgetAura::SetWindowTitle(const base::string16& title) { |
| void NativeWidgetAura::SetWindowIcons(const gfx::ImageSkia& window_icon, |
| const gfx::ImageSkia& app_icon) { |
| - // Aura doesn't have window icons. |
| + if (window_) { |
| + window_->SetProperty( |
|
sky
2016/08/09 21:24:27
How about making this function public static in Na
qiangchen
2016/08/09 22:07:35
Done.
|
| + aura::client::kWindowIconKey, |
| + new gfx::ImageSkia(!window_icon.isNull() ? window_icon : app_icon)); |
| + } |
| } |
| void NativeWidgetAura::InitModalType(ui::ModalType modal_type) { |